ZTE Unveils WiMAX Mobile Video Surveillance Terminal

(Top News, 14 Jan 2009 )

ZTE Corporation recently announced its latest Mi100 device, said to be the world’s first WiMAX Mobile Video Surveillance Terminal. The new device is the result of ZTE’s relentless R&D efforts and expertise in developing state-of-the-art WiMAX equipment and solutions.

Integrated with highly advanced WiMAX 16e chipset, the Mi100 smoothly enables automatic access and connection to WiMAX wireless network. It supports high-speed mobile remote surveillance of up to a maximum speed of 100km/h. With a compact and portable size of only 115x62x50mm, the Mi100 terminal is easy to install and does not require additional modulated decoder compared with traditional mobile video surveillance terminals. It can also be deployed in public areas such as airports, highways, hospitals and railways, facilitating mass WiMAX applications in transportation, utilities, irrigation works, oil fields, as well as government departments.

ZTE is one of the few vendors in the world that pioneered research and development on WiMAX. It is also the only Chinese company with a representative in the 15-man Board of Directors in the WiMAX Forum, and with about a dozen of WiMAX R&D institutions located in different regions globally.

As of November 2008, ZTE has already deployed more than 30 WiMAX 16e networks across different regions and countries, including Asia-Pacific, Middle East, Africa, Europe, and the Americas region. In October 2008, the company received the Wave2 Qualification Certification from the WiMAX Forum, the first Chinese company to ever receive dual award for its network equipment and terminal products from the same organization.

ZTE has also forged partnerships with more than 120 operators worldwide to exchange insights and technical views on WiMAX 16e standards, network planning and construction, and other related industry developments.
